vogue~, not too early to start... just be flexible cos a routine isn't cast in stone. Not sure if this'll help cos Kyle's bn bit erratic with sleep lately. But my routine for him is only a night sleep one - not a timetable. Whatever time is his last feed for the day, he gets bathed, moisturised n nursed, then put down. Lights are dimmed n room quiet. No playing n little talking. This can be as early as 9pm or as late as midnight when we have functions to attend. I've adopted this approach cos it suits my unpredictable days most n Kyle seems to be thriving until the last week or so.
Daytime naps i leave up to him. But i don't darken room or keep things quiet intentionally. If babies are overtired, they end up fractious n unable to sleep properly instead because they may be too upset. They need AT LEAST 3hrs of naps thru'out the day.
Do note that growth spurts do not last long... usually a couple of days. So perhaps it'll pass soon if it is one.
